Abstract
Three parasitic gastropod species – Melanella bovicornu Pilsbry, 1905; Prosimniasemperi Weinkauff, 1881 and Epidendriumaureum Gittenberger and Gittenberger, 2005 – are recorded for the first time from the Indian waters of the Andaman and Nicobar Islands. Brief species descriptions and their host association are provided.Downloads
